Why Consider a Specialist

Oracle Java licensing looks simple… until an audit notice arrives. Suddenly, the rules get confusing, and the stakes get high.

Java used to be free for many uses, but Oracle’s newer licensing models (like per-employee subscriptions) have changed the game. A specialist firm knows Oracle’s playbook — and how to turn it around in your favor.

These experts have seen Oracle’s tactics up close. They know the contract fine print and the technical gotchas Oracle’s auditors look for. An independent licensing specialist will protect your interests and level the playing field.

How can a Java licensing advisor help? They guide you on:

  • Compliance validation: Audit your Java deployments to confirm what is and isn’t properly licensed. No guessing – you get clarity on your compliance status.
  • Audit defense: If Oracle’s audit team comes knocking, the firm builds a defensible position and manages communications, so you don’t accidentally concede to exaggerated claims.
  • Contract negotiation: Seasoned advisors negotiate with Oracle for you. They push back on onerous terms, secure better pricing, and ensure your contracts don’t have hidden traps.
  • Renewal cost reduction: When it’s time to renew Java subscriptions, experts find ways to reduce costs. They might identify unused licenses, suggest alternative products (like OpenJDK or other vendors), or right-size your subscription scope before Oracle overcharges you.

In short, a Java licensing specialist helps you stay compliant, pay only for what you truly need, and avoid getting steamrolled by Oracle’s hardball tactics.

When to Engage

How do you know it’s time to call in the Oracle Java licensing pros? Don’t wait for a full-blown crisis.

Engage an advisor if any of these situations apply:

  • You’ve received an Oracle inquiry. Even a casual email or call from Oracle about Java usage can signal an upcoming audit. Bring in an expert within days of the first contact. Early action can set the tone and strategy for what comes next.
  • Your Java renewal is approaching. If your Oracle Java subscription renewal is within the next 6–12 months, now is the time to strategize. Advisors can review what you’re using, ensure you’re not over-buying, and negotiate better renewal terms before Oracle’s sales team has you in a corner.
  • You’re unsure about Oracle’s employee-based licensing. Oracle recently changed its Java licensing model, charging based on your employee count. If you find this confusing or worry you might be out of compliance, don’t guess. Specialists can clarify exactly how the rules apply to your business and prevent costly missteps.
  • You’re considering migration away from Oracle Java. Maybe you plan to switch to OpenJDK or another platform to escape Oracle fees. Advisors can chart a safe exit path. They’ll ensure you replace all Oracle-provided Java components and document everything, so you don’t get hit with surprise fees later.

How to Evaluate Your Options

When comparing Oracle licensing advisory firms, keep a critical eye. It’s not just about rank or reputation – verify what they can actually do for you.

Use the following criteria as you evaluate different options:

  • Independence: Ensure the firm has no official Oracle partner status or reselling business. True independence means their only loyalty is to the client.
  • Track Record: Look for case studies or references that prove they’ve delivered results (e.g., audit penalties avoided, millions saved on renewals). A history of success in Oracle Java cases is the best indicator.
  • Expertise: The team should demonstrate both legal and technical Oracle knowledge. You want seasoned licensing specialists, including former Oracle auditors or contract negotiators, who understand both the contract language and the technical deployment side.
  • Transparent Fees: Seek clear, fixed-fee pricing if possible. Avoid open-ended hourly deals that could escalate. A reliable firm will scope the work and offer a flat or not-to-exceed fee, giving you cost predictability.
  • Guarantees: Does the firm offer any written guarantees of deliverables or outcomes? For example, some might guarantee no back-license fees from an audit if you follow their plan, or promise a certain percentage of cost savings. Guarantees show confidence in their work (just read the fine print).

Evaluate each prospective advisor against this checklist. If a firm scores well on all counts, you likely have a strong candidate.

Checklist – Before You Sign

You’ve identified a promising Oracle Java licensing advisor. Before you sign on the dotted line, run through this final checklist:

  • Review the engagement scope and guarantees. Make sure it’s crystal clear what the firm will deliver, and note any promised results in the contract. No vague language – everything should be spelled out.
  • Confirm independence. Double-check that the firm truly has no ties to Oracle. (If you find they’re listed as an Oracle partner or reseller, walk away.)
  • Ask who performs the work (not just software tools). Will you have experienced consultants working on your case, or are they just running a scanner and spitting out a report? You want hands-on expertise, not an automated black box.
  • Verify their Oracle LMS experience. Don’t hesitate to ask whether they have team members who’ve worked with Oracle License Management Services or led Oracle audits. Knowing the enemy’s playbook is a huge advantage.
  • Align timelines with your needs. Ensure the advisory engagement covers the required period. For example, if you have an audit response due in 3 months or a renewal in 6 months, the contract with the firm should extend through those critical dates. You don’t want support ending right before your big negotiation.

When to Call Them In

Timing is everything. Bringing in an Oracle Java licensing advisory firm at the right moment can dramatically improve your outcomes.

Here’s when to make the call:

  • Audit Notice: Engage an advisor within one week of receiving any Oracle audit notice or formal letter. The first days after an audit notification are key for strategy—don’t go it alone or delay.
  • Renewal Upcoming: Engage about six months before your Java subscription renewal date. This gives ample time to assess usage, consider alternatives, and let the advisor conduct negotiations well before Oracle’s deadline pressure kicks in.
  • Migration Planning: Engage as soon as you start thinking about migrating away from Oracle Java (or significant architectural changes). An early consultation will map out a clean break strategy, ensuring you don’t accidentally create compliance gaps during the transition.

Delaying engagement can leave you negotiating blind. Oracle’s team will have had months (or years) to prepare their approach – you deserve to be just as prepared.

Early expert involvement means you won’t be scrambling at the last minute, or worse, unknowingly agreeing to unfavorable terms.
